## Service Accounts — StormFan Alert Fan-Out

The fan-out worker authenticates to the internal dispatch tier using the svc-stormfan account. Rotate quarterly; scopes are limited to publish-only on alert topics. If deliveries stall during your shift, verify the worker is using the current credential, reproduced below for reference.

API key for kaweg-hahif: kto4_rAjZ

**Handover: Graphwick maintenance**

Graphwick renders the dependency graph nightly from the build manifest; the layout engine is the slow part, so the cache matters. Known quirk: cyclic dev dependencies render twice — harmless but ugly. Everything else is stable. The service reads one config file at startup, and the values currently in production are these.

service settings:
druael:
  pin: 7528
  metrics_host: metrics.druael.lumiclabs.internal
  tenant: wendor
  seal: seal_c765840a

**Runbook fragment — Gatewright rate-limit rollout**

Release manager: deploy the updated rate-limit config to the internal gateway in two waves, canary first. The policy bundle must be signed before the gateway will load it; unsigned bundles are rejected silently, which looks like a no-op deploy. Verify the limiter counters move on the canary before wave two. Sign the bundle with the current release key, reproduced below for convenience.

rollout seal: bky4_x7Gc

## Step 4: Stabilize integration tests before cutover

The Ledgerline payments suite has three flaky integration tests caused by clock skew in the sandbox settlement mock. Pin the mock's timezone and retry budget before migrating, or the cutover verification run will intermittently fail. Apply the settings below exactly as written, in this order.

deployment values, fadug-bawif:
SORWYN_LOG_LEVEL=debug
SORWYN_METRICS_HOST=metrics.sorwyn.qirvansys.internal
SORWYN_POOL_SIZE=32

Handover: Catalog cache invalidation — Brindlemart

For the contractor: invalidation is event-driven. Price or stock change publishes to the purge queue; edge nodes drop keys within 2s. Known gap: bundle SKUs don't cascade — manual purge needed, script in the tools repo. Don't flush the whole cache; origin can't take it. TTL fallback is 10 minutes. Dashboards are under "catalog-cache." Admin purge console unlocks with the recovery passphrase below.

unlock words, kagef-taduf: fenir-quenix-norwyn-sorvan-gormir-gorir-fraok